I submitted my FLR(M) application in October and this week I received all my documents and a letter from the Home Office that states:

"This application is not being considered and your documents are being returned to you as your currently have an excess amount of extant leave until the [Date] of [Month] 2017. Because of this, a request for a full refund of your fee is also being made. Your spouse's application for indefinite leave to remain is still outstanding and will be considered soon."

FYI, my spouse is currently on TIER 2 VISA until 2017 and has applied for ILR (based on 10 year long residency) in September and he is hoping to get his ILR visa sometime in Jan-Feb 2015.
